KANSAS CITY, MO (KCTV) - The Nativity of Mary is where 11-year-old Blair Lane attended class and where parishioners gathered to pray the rosary for a young life taken much too soon.

KCMO police have spent the past two days trying to track down who's responsible for the death of the Lane, who was shot while celebrating the Fourth of July.

Lane was watching the fireworks from the backyard of her uncle's home Monday night when she was hit in the neck by a stray bullet - an injury that later proved fatal.

This little girl seemed like she was so smart and compassionate. It upset her when foster children would come into her family with no socks, so she wanted to start a project called Foster Socks. Her family is now trying to bring everything together to make that happen in her memory. What a beautiful way to honor a little girl who left this earth far too soon.
